Developing a gender-sensitive measurement of multidimensional poverty

Data on poverty often have a gender data gap– oftentimes, data on poverty is typically measured at the household level rather than the individual level. Developed by Equality Insights, the Individual Deprivation Measure, is a survey tool that assesses 15 socio-economic dimensions of multidimensional deprivation, along with sampling every adult member in the household. The Individual Deprivation Measure can be used by national statistical office in producing individual-level poverty data; it can also be used by policy makers and advocates, helping them to target poverty more effectively and achieve SDG 1.
